MRX-2843 is an orally bioavailable, small molecule inhibitor of the receptor tyrosine kinases MerTK (tyrosine-protein kinase Mer) and FLT3 (Fms-like tyrosine kinase 3). It acts by binding to and inhibiting both MerTK and FLT3, preventing their ligand-dependent phosphorylation and activation. This inhibition blocks downstream signaling pathways involved in cell proliferation and survival, leading to apoptosis and reduced proliferation in tumor cells overexpressing these kinases. MRX-2843 has demonstrated preclinical efficacy against acute myeloid leukemia (AML), including models resistant to other FLT3 inhibitors due to D835 or F691 mutations, as well as activity in MERTK-dependent AML models. The drug is being developed by Emory University/Meryx/National Cancer Institute for various hematologic malignancies such as AML, acute lymphoblastic leukemia (ALL), mixed phenotype acute leukemia, as well as solid tumors including non-small cell lung cancer.
